Description

Broaching device with automatic tool changing mechanism
The technical field is as follows:
the utility model relates to a machining equipment field, especially a broaching device with automatic tool changing mechanism.
Background art:
with the continuous upgrading and upgrading of the Chinese manufacturing industry, the demand on the automatic honing machine is more and more, and further higher requirements are provided for the structural design of honing equipment. The assembly and manufacturing technology is rapidly developed, and the application of the automatic broaching machine is more and more popular. Because of the 24-hour continuous operation of the automatic production line, when the broach for production reaches a certain broaching frequency, the broach needs to be manually changed in time for production, the shutdown time is increased when the broach is manually changed every time, the production line cannot be continuously operated, and therefore the production cost is increased.

The specific implementation mode is as follows:
in order to deepen the understanding of the present invention, the present invention will be further described in detail with reference to the following embodiments and the attached drawings, and the embodiments are only used for explaining the present invention, and do not constitute the limitation to the protection scope of the present invention.
Fig. 1 to 4 show an embodiment of a broaching device with an automatic tool changing mechanism: the broaching machine comprises a broaching machine main body 9, wherein a broaching machine tool magazine 14 is arranged on one side of the broaching machine main body 9, an upper clamping seat 12 is installed on the broaching machine main body 9 through a lifting device, a lower clamping seat 8 is installed on the machine tool main body 9 right below the upper clamping seat 12, a tool arm swinging servo motor 11 is installed on the upper clamping seat 12, a tool arm 3 is installed at the lower end of the tool arm swinging servo motor 11, a clamping jaw 4 is installed at the front end of the tool arm 3, the clamping jaw 4 is used for grabbing a broaching tool, an original broaching tool A5 is installed on the lower clamping seat 8, and a plurality of new broaching tools B6 are installed on the broaching machine tool magazine 14;
the lifting device comprises a linear track A7, a linear track B10, a tool arm lifting servo motor 1 and a tool arm lifting screw rod 2, wherein the linear track A7 and the linear track B10 are symmetrically arranged on the broaching machine body 9, the lower part of the tool arm lifting servo motor 1 is connected with the tool arm lifting screw rod 2, the upper clamping seat 12 is arranged on the linear track A7 and the linear track B10, and the tool arm lifting servo motor 1 drives the upper clamping seat 12 to move up and down along the linear track A7 and the linear track B10 through the tool arm lifting screw rod 2;
the broaching machine tool magazine 14 comprises a broaching tool mounting disc 141, a rotating motor 142 and positioning tool sleeves 13, the positioning tool sleeves 13 are uniformly mounted on the broaching tool mounting disc 141, and the rotating motor 142 is arranged below the broaching tool mounting disc 141; the end of the output shaft of the rotating motor 142 is connected to the broach mounting plate 141 through a speed reducer, and drives the broach mounting plate 141 to rotate, so as to rotate the tool magazine.
A vacancy reminding device is arranged in the positioning knife sleeve 13.
Tool changing working process:
when the broaching machine needs to replace the broaching tool, the tool arm swinging servo motor 11 rotates the tool arm 3 to grab the original broaching tool A5 on the lower clamping seat 8 of the broaching machine by the claw 4, then the broaching tool A5 is pulled out of the lower clamping seat 8, then the tool arm 3 is rotated to send the broaching tool A5 to the upper part of the tool magazine 14 of the broaching machine, then the tool arm 3 moves downwards along the line track A7 and the line track B9 under the driving of the tool arm lifting servo motor 1, and the broaching tool A5 is placed back into the corresponding positioning tool sleeve 13.
Then, the broaching machine tool magazine 14 transfers the broaching tool B6 to be replaced to the position below the tool claw 4, the tool claw 4 grabs the broaching tool B6, the broaching tool B6 is driven by the tool arm lifting servo motor 1 to ascend along the line track A7 and the line track B9, after the broaching tool B6 leaves the broaching machine tool magazine 14, the tool arm swinging servo motor 11 rotates the tool arm 3 to move the broaching tool B6 to the position above the lower clamping seat 8, and then the broaching tool B6 is placed in the lower clamping seat 8, so that a tool changing procedure is completed.
